Finally received my first lightsaber today
Box was a bit squashed on the end, but everything inside seemed to be ok. The only issue right out of the box was with one of the threads being wedged at an angle. After I was able to finally get it out, it seems that it happened due to a fairly deep chamber into which male part can screw all the way in past any threads and thus wobble around. I imagine during shipping it went all the way in and then wedged itself at an angle. Would be good if either female threads would go all the way down or male thread part was longer.

Over everything seem to be made quite well.
Threads are a bit too loose when not glued down, but that should be fixed when they are glued (will need to figure out what to use for that, for now I used some plumbers tape and bit of super glue...).
The blade itself wobbles in the socket. Tape helped a bit, but it's not solid still, even though it takes some doing to seat it in with the tape.
There were few scratches on the hilt here and there, although since I used sandpaper on it right away, was not an issue for me, but if you are looking for perfect finish out of the box, you may be a bit disappointed. And those ridged on the hilt were rather sharp before I filed them down a bit, actually cut myself with something on the hilt at some point lol.
